Ann Barker Library

A searchable library of past issues of Iowa Bird Life from 1931 - 2009.   This great resource was made possible by a bequest from former president Ann Barker and was created as a memorial to her.

Iowa Breeding Bird Atlas

The second atlas project is capturing data on breeding birds from 2008 through 2012.  Iowa birders enter their data in this application and everyone can follow the progress in real time. Be sure to check out the distribution changes since the first project in 1985 - 1990 with the overlay map.

Iowa's Important Bird Areas

In partnership with Iowa Audubon, IOU members have nominated and then provided data to support designations of IBAs in Iowa.  Continued monitoring of these areas are supported by data entered into the IOU seasonal field reports.
